Experimental study on Jiedu Huayu Granules regulating ROS-NLRP3 signaling pathway to alleviate liver inflammatory stress in rats with liver failure
Objective To analyze the molecular mechanism of Jiedu Huayu Granules(JDHY)in improving liver inflammation in rats with liver failure by regulating ROS-NLRP3 signaling pathway.Methods Thirty-six male Wistar rats were randomly divid-ed into control group,model group and JDHY group,with 12 rats in each group.A rat model of acute liver failure was established by intraperitoneal injection of D-galactosamine(D-GalN)combined with lipopolysaccharide(LPS).JDHY group was given JDHY(57.55 g·kg-1·d-1)before modeling,continuous intragastric administration for 72 h and continued to 24 h after model-ing.Rats in each group were sacrificed 24 h after modeling.Serum and tissue samples were collected.Serum ALT,AST and TBIL levels were measured by automatic biochemical analyzer.Serum IL-1β and IL-18 were measured by ELISA.ROS pro-duction was evaluated.The expression of NLRP3 and GSDMD in liver tissue was analyzed by immunohistochemistry.The expres-sion of NLRP3,GSDMD,GSDMD-N,ASC and Caspase-1 in liver tissue was analyzed by Western blotting.Results JDHY could effectively improve liver function(ALT,AST,TBIL)(P<0.05),reduce the excessive production of ROS(P<0.05)and the release of inflammatory factors(IL-1β,IL-18)in rats with liver failure.In addition,compared with the model group,JDHY reduced the expression of NLRP3,GSDMD,GSDMD-N,ASC and Caspase-1 in liver tissue of rats with liver failure(P<0.05).Conclusion JDHY can inhibit the excessive activation of ROS-NLRP3 signaling pathway,reduce the release of pro-inflammatory factors,alleviate the level of liver inflammatory stress and antagonize liver failure.
